USE[DATABASENAEM]; 数据库的管理其实没什么太复杂的,它就像一个容器一样,创建后就意味着占有了一块磁盘空间,具体的数据存储还是在表结构中,所以接下来我们来看看数据库表管理情况。 表管理 关系型数据库中对于数据的存储采用一种符合人的思维逻辑的结构进行存储,那就是表格结构。 表格是一个二维的结构,有行和列,我们管一行数据叫做『一条记录』
(2) 随机IO刷新的比较慢,一个事务可能包含很多语句,即使是一条语句也可能修改许多页面,而且这些页面可能并不相邻。这就意味着在将某个事务修改的Buffer Pool中的页面刷新到磁盘时,需要进行很多的随机IO。 我们只是想让已经提交了的事务对数据库中的数据所在的修改能永久生效,即使后来系统崩溃,在重启后也能把这种修...
现在我们能够通过Internet访问数据库,这意味着顾客(数据的用户)使用浏览器(比如IE、Microsoft Edge和Firefox )就能访问公司的信息,能够定购货物、盘点库存、查看订单状态、对账户进行管理变更、转账等。 用户只需打开浏览器,访问公司的站点并登录(如果公司的站...
括号内的查询语句被称为派生表,我们给它指定了一个别名叫做 t。同样,整个查询结果也是一个表;这就意味着我们可以继续嵌套,虽然这么做很无聊。 我们再看一个 PostgreSQL 中的示例: -- PostgreSQL SELECT * FROM upper('sql'); | upper | |---| | SQL | upper()是一个大写转换的函数。它出现再 FROM 子...
对象持久性:OODB 提供对象持久性,这意味着对象可以直接存储在数据库中而无需对象关系映射。这种本机持久性简化了开发,降低了复杂性,并支持对数据库中的对象进行透明和直接的操作。 复杂数据模型:OODB 擅长处理复杂数据模型,包括互连、嵌套和异构数据结构。它们支持复杂的关系、关联和聚合,使其适用于需要丰富数据建模功...
– 数据持久化:SQL语言用于定义和操作数据库,可以在数据库中持久化数据。这意味着数据可以长期存储并随时检索,非常适用于需要频繁读写数据的业务场景。 – 强大的数据处理能力:SQL提供了丰富的查询和聚合函数,可以进行复杂的数据分析和统计计算。同时,SQL还支持连接多个表、子查询和嵌套查询等高级功能,使得数据处理更加...
数据行是记录在逻辑结构 page 页中的,而每一个页的大小是固定的,默认16K。 那也就意味着, 一个...
SQLSTATE 値意味 08001 アプリケーション・サーバーまたはその他のサーバーへの接続を確立できませんでした。 08002 接続が既に存在しています。 08003 接続が存在しません。 08004 アプリケーション・サーバーが接続の確立を拒否しました。 表7. クラス・コード 09: トリガー・アクシ...
即全表扫描,意味着mysql需要从头到尾去查找所需要的行。通常情况下这需要增加索引来进行优化了 mysql> explain select * from actor;possible_keys列 这一列显示查询可能使用哪些索引来查找。explain 时可能出现 possible_keys 有列,而 key 显示 NULL 的情况,这种情况是因为表中数据不多,mysql认为索引对此查询...
但是,第 2 点是我想解决的问题。在 JavaScript 领域,前端和后端之间的界限变得越来越模糊,我认为这实际上非常酷。前端开发人员现在可以做以前需要深入后端知识的事情。但是,这并不意味着你应该跳过基础知识。SQL 是数据库的语言,如果你是一位使用 PostgreSQL 的 JavaScript 开发人员,那么即使你最终使用 JavaScript ...